ABSTRACT:
A split connecting rod includes a fracture start groove that extends in an axial direction X and is located at the approximate center of each of opposing positions on an inner surface of a crank pin opening. A bearing securing groove is provided on either or both of the opposing positions on the inner surface of the crank pin opening. Notches are provided, respectively, at both ends of each of the opposing positions in the axial direction X on the inner surface of the crank pin opening. The fracture start groove has a stress concentration factor that is greater than those of the notches and the bearing securing groove. Preferably, steel for use as the material of a connecting rod has a carbon content of about 0.05% to about 0.45% by weight, more preferably about 0.10% to about 0.35% by weight.
